Access Bank, a leading financial institution, has made a significant stride in the credit card market by unveiling two highly anticipated consumer credit cards: the Access Bank American Express Gold Card and the Metal Platinum Card.
These cards mark the inaugural introduction of American Express in Nigeria and West Africa, becoming the first-ever to be issued in the region. American Express is a globally recognized brand known for its premium services and benefits.

In the year 2019, Access Bank forged a partnership with American Express, laying the groundwork to facilitate merchant acquisitions. This collaboration aimed to empower businesses throughout the nation, granting them the capability to receive payments from American Express Cards issued abroad.
As a significant milestone, Access Bank has reached the stage where it is prepared to introduce the inaugural American Express credit cards in West Africa.
In addition to providing dual-currency functionality (NGN/USD) and being widely accepted internationally, American Express cards offer a range of exclusive benefits.
These include access to airport lounges, perks for car rentals, membership rewards, loyalty points, as well as insurance coverage and protections.
The Platinum Card takes these features a step further by providing enhanced airport lounge benefits. Cardholders can enjoy complimentary access to over 1,400 lounges worldwide through the American Express Global Lounge Collection.
Furthermore, the Platinum Card offers a variety of hotel perks and upgrades through The Hotel Collection and Fine Hotels + Resorts. It also grants special status access to esteemed loyalty programs such as Hilton Honours, Radisson Rewards, and Marriott Bonvoy.
Cardholders can also enjoy complimentary access to prestigious hotel membership programs, including Tablet Plus membership and Mr & Mrs. Smith Gold status. Additionally, 24/7 travel and lifestyle concierge services are available to cater to the needs of Platinum Card members.
Herbert Wigwe, the Group Managing Director of Access Holdings, announced that the cards will be accessible upon request and invitation. Customers who have expressed their interest will have the opportunity to start using the cards starting from today, Tuesday, June 13, 2023.

During the simultaneous launch of the cards in London, Roosevelt Ogbonna, the Managing Director and CEO of Access Bank, emphasized the significance of introducing American Express Cards in Nigeria, stating, “This event marks a remarkable milestone in the ongoing evolution of a dynamic and rapidly expanding payments sector. Today, customers seek more than mere transactions; they desire genuine value.”
